Frequently Asked Questions
How often should I have my septic system inspected?
It is recommended to have your septic system inspected at least once every three years by a professional.
What are the signs of a failing septic system?
Signs include slow drains, foul odors, pooling water, and lush patches of grass over the drain field.
Can I use chemical additives in my septic system?
It is generally not recommended as chemicals can disrupt the natural bacterial balance necessary for waste breakdown.
How can I prevent septic system problems?
Regular maintenance, avoiding overloading the system, and being mindful of what goes down the drains can prevent issues.
